What is roadside assistance in a car?

Roadside assistance refers to a combination of services that help drivers with various mechanical and towing solutions. The issues roadside services can resolve ranges from flat Tyre and dead battery to minor repair and vehicle recovery. We know things can get so unpredictable on the road. Roadside Assistance (or ‘roadside recovery’) is a basic level of breakdown cover. This is where a patrol comes out to you if you break down over ΒΌ mile from your home address. They’ll try to fix you on the spot. And if they can’t, they’ll tow you to a local garage.Roadside assistance is a service provided to motorists who find themselves stranded due to vehicle breakdowns. It’s a safety net for issues like flat tyres, dead batteries, empty fuel tanks, or mechanical failures. In Australia, this service is often a lifeline, given the vast distances between destinations.

Limited Number of Service Calls AAA limits the number of roadside assistance calls you can make per year based on your membership level. Exceeding this limit may result in additional fees or reduced service coverage.Annual Membership Fee One of the biggest downsides to AAA is the cost. Membership fees range from about $50 to $130 or more per year, depending on the level of coverage you choose. For drivers who rarely face auto problems, this annual cost may outweigh the benefits of membership.Insurance-provided roadside assistance programs are usually cheaper than AAA. Roadside assistance is factored into your monthly bill just as your comprehensive or collision coverage would be.AAA Roadside Assistance may be more comprehensive than what you can get from a dealership or your insurance company. Your AAA membership will cover you in any car that you are driving or riding in. And the perks don’t end at the roadside. AAA Battery Service can get you back on the road in a hurry.

What does roadside assistance cover you for?

Roadside assistance is a service provided by car brands and insurance companies to help you if your car breaks down. They are often the first point of call in an emergency so are an important contact to have for all drivers, especially those driving long distances. Most insurance providers offer roadside assistance as an add-on policy, but some plans provide better coverage than others. Allstate, Farmers, and GEICO offer some of the best add-on options for roadside assistance.Do you need roadside assistance coverage? Whether you want to buy a roadside assistance plan is a personal choice. If you only drive short distances or have coverage automatically through your car manufacturer or credit card company, you might not want to spring for the extra protection.
